当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机vmx文件在哪,虚拟机VMX文件的位置与深入解析,揭秘虚拟化技术的核心秘密

虚拟机vmx文件在哪,虚拟机VMX文件的位置与深入解析,揭秘虚拟化技术的核心秘密

虚拟机VMX文件存储位置解析:VMX文件是虚拟化技术的核心,通常位于虚拟机所在目录。深入解析其结构,揭示虚拟化技术的奥秘。...

虚拟机VMX文件存储位置解析:VMX文件是虚拟化技术的核心,通常位于虚拟机所在目录。深入解析其结构,揭示虚拟化技术的奥秘。

随着云计算和虚拟化技术的不断发展,虚拟机(VM)已成为现代数据中心和服务器架构的重要组成部分,虚拟机提供了灵活、高效、安全的应用环境,广泛应用于企业级应用、云计算平台和软件开发等领域,VMX文件作为虚拟机的配置文件,记录了虚拟机的详细配置信息,对于理解虚拟化技术具有重要意义,本文将探讨虚拟机VMX文件的位置,并对VMX文件进行深入解析,揭示虚拟化技术的核心秘密。

虚拟机VMX文件的位置

1、虚拟机安装目录

在默认情况下,虚拟机VMX文件位于虚拟机安装目录下,以下以VMware Workstation为例,说明VMX文件的位置:

(1)Windows系统:C:Program Files (x86)VMwareVMware Workstationmyvm.vmx

(2)Linux系统:/usr/lib/vmware/vmware-workstation/myvm.vmx

虚拟机vmx文件在哪,虚拟机VMX文件的位置与深入解析,揭秘虚拟化技术的核心秘密

2、自定义路径

用户可以在创建虚拟机时自定义VMX文件的位置,在虚拟机安装过程中,选择“自定义位置”选项,即可设置VMX文件保存路径。

虚拟机VMX文件的结构

VMX文件采用XML格式,主要由以下几部分组成:

1、版本信息

版本信息定义了VMX文件的版本和格式。

VMware VMX version 10

2、虚拟机配置

虚拟机配置部分记录了虚拟机的硬件和软件设置,包括CPU、内存、硬盘、网络、显示器等,以下是一些常见的配置项:

(1)CPU配置:

虚拟机vmx文件在哪,虚拟机VMX文件的位置与深入解析,揭秘虚拟化技术的核心秘密

cpus högsta = "2"
cpus.max = "2"
cpus.mode = "Host"

(2)内存配置:

memsize = "2048"
memsize.max = "2048"
memsizeInc = "1024"

(3)硬盘配置:

scsi0:0.fileName = "myvm.vmdk"
scsi0:0.startConnected = "TRUE"
scsi0:0.fileType = "vmdk"

(4)网络配置:

eth0.networkType = "bridged"
eth0.bridge = "VMnet1"

3、虚拟机启动选项

虚拟机启动选项定义了虚拟机的启动参数,如引导顺序、启动时加载的驱动等,以下是一些常见的启动选项:

floppy0.startConnected = "FALSE"
floppy0.fileName = ""
cdrom0.startConnected = "TRUE"
cdrom0.fileName = "C:Program Files (x86)VMwareVMware Workstationmyvm.iso"

4、其他配置

VMX文件还包含其他配置项,如虚拟机名称、UUID、电源管理、快照等。

虚拟机VMX文件的作用

1、硬件和软件配置

虚拟机vmx文件在哪,虚拟机VMX文件的位置与深入解析,揭秘虚拟化技术的核心秘密

VMX文件记录了虚拟机的硬件和软件配置,确保虚拟机在启动时能够正常运行。

2、虚拟机迁移

VMX文件在虚拟机迁移过程中发挥着重要作用,在迁移过程中,源虚拟机的VMX文件将被复制到目标主机,确保目标虚拟机与源虚拟机具有相同的配置。

3、虚拟机备份和恢复

VMX文件与虚拟硬盘文件(如VMDK)一起,构成了虚拟机的完整备份,在虚拟机恢复过程中,需要同时恢复VMX文件和VMDK文件。

虚拟机VMX文件是虚拟化技术的核心组成部分,记录了虚拟机的详细配置信息,了解VMX文件的位置和结构,有助于我们更好地理解虚拟化技术,并对其进行优化和配置,本文对虚拟机VMX文件进行了深入解析,希望对读者有所帮助。

黑狐家游戏

发表评论

最新文章